External Anatomy. 1. Determine the sex of your pig by looking for the urogenital opening. On females, this opening is located near the anus. On males, the opening is located near the umbilical cord. WebThe brain stem consists of three main areas: midbrain, pons, and medulla oblongata. The medulla oblongata (m.o.) connects the brain to the spinal cord. It regulates breathing and heart rate. Color the medulla oblongata orange. Superior to the medulla oblongata is the pons (p.), the name is Latin for “bridge.”.
